How to sterilize clean room

The air through the sub-high efficiency or high efficiency filter can be regarded as sterile air, but filtration is only a means of sterilization, and there is no sterilization effect, because there are personnel, materials and other sources of pollution in the clean room of the food factory, so as long as there are nutrients needed by microorganisms, it can make microorganisms survive and multiply. Therefore, disinfection and sterilization measures can never be ignored in the design and management of clean room in food factories.

Traditional sterilization methods include ultraviolet sterilization, pharmaceutical sterilization and heating sterilization. These methods are well known and their safety and reliability have been confirmed by long-term practice. But these methods also have their own defects, such as ultraviolet sterilization, the device is more convenient to set up and use, but because of limited penetration capacity, the place where ultraviolet radiation is less than, the sterilization effect is not good, and the lamp life is short, frequent replacement, high operating cost; Chemical reagent sterilization, such as formaldehyde fumigation, troublesome operation, long fumigation time, secondary pollutants, there is a certain harm to the body, fumigation residue attached to the wall and equipment surface of the clean room, need to be cleaned, sometimes improper treatment, in a few days after sterilization, the number of suspended particles will increase; Heating sterilization includes dry heat and wet heat, its disadvantages are high temperature, high energy consumption, some items such as some raw materials, instruments and meters, plastic products, etc., should not be used.

In recent years, ozone sterilization in pharmaceutical products, biological drugs manufacturing process has been increasingly widely used, ozone is a broad-spectrum fungicide, can kill bacteria and spores, viruses, fungi, etc., can destroy endotoxin. Ozone kills bacteria faster than chlorine in water. Ozone sterilization method has been used in some biological clean rooms for disinfection and sterilization of pipes and containers, through the purification of air conditioning system to clean room sterilization, surface disinfection and water disinfection and so on.

Which sterilization method is used in the specific food factory clean room should be determined according to the use of food factory clean room, product production process characteristics and the actual situation of the production equipment used.

Ozone (O3) is the isotrope of oxygen. Ozone is a strong oxidant, and its sterilization process belongs to biochemical oxidation reaction, which decomposes glucose oxidase necessary for glucose oxidation in bacteria. It can act directly with bacteria and viruses to destroy their cells and ribonucleic acid. Ozone is dissolved mold sterilization agent, when the air is contained in a certain concentration of ozone (2 ~ 15) x 10-6], the internal structure of bacteria, viruses and other microorganisms strong oxidative damaging, to kill bacteria breeding, spore, armour hepatitis b virus, such as bacteria, fungi and protozoa cystic can also damage the toxins botox and rickettsia, etc. Ozone has a strong mildew, fishy, smelly, mildew, moth - proof and other functions.

Compared with ultraviolet method and chemical fumigation method, ozone sterilization method has the advantages of convenient operation and use, unlike formaldehyde fumigation method, time-consuming labor, and no secondary pollution cleaning problems; Unlike the dead spots that ultraviolet radiation can cause, the diffusion of ozone can disinfect and sterilize any corner. At present, ozone sterilization method has been used in more than 200 domestic pharmaceutical factories, mainly used for clean room disinfection and sterilization and purification of air conditioning system, pure water and injection water disinfection and sterilization, more than 20 through GMP certification. Ozone sterilization in clean rooms of pharmaceutical factories is generally to install ozone generators in appropriate locations such as purification and air conditioning systems. When disinfecting and sterilizing, close the fresh air inlet and return air discharge air valve, so that the whole disinfected clean room air of the device forms a circulation state through the air duct, and start air sterilization for 1 to 1.5 hours every day.
